About Marie-Claude Barc

Marie-Claude Barc is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Food Science and Immunology, having authored 14 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Clostridium difficile and Clostridium perfringens research (14 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(5 papers) and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(726 citations), Endocrinology (82 citations) and Gastroenterology (52 citations). Marie-Claude Barc has collaborated with scholars based in France, Belgium and Morocco. Frequent co-authors include Anne Collignon, T. Karjalainen, Albert Tasteyre, P. Bourlioux, H. Boureau, Claire Hennequin, Claire Janoir, Michel Delmée, Anne‐Judith Waligora‐Dupriet and Fabrice Porcheray. Their work appears in journals such as Applied and Environmental Microbiology, Journal of Clinical Microbiology and Infection and Immunity.
